Transaction 8221d563a361f2437924818dfdd0035f09e81028a3c51c1d91c5d624169a55e6
1 Input
1 Output
-
8221d563a361f2437924818dfdd0035f09e81028a3c51c1d91c5d624169a55e6:0
- value
- 17476365
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e58a7ef561a89b88694f34727164ecbf94f266e OP_EQUAL
- address
- MF3R9KVAmuyKL5PiPJ5WhAgafMLXxB5oxV